BEFORE A LISTING APPOINTMENT

"What sold within a mile of this property in the last 90 days?" Comps pulled before you even open MLS. Walk in already oriented.

"What's the strongest pricing strategy for this listing based on what's actually moved?" Context-aware analysis. Not theory. What's sold and at what price.

"What objections am I likely to hear from this seller?" Drawn from your notes and property data. You won't be caught off guard.

"Summarize everything I have on [client name] before my meeting at 2." All your notes and calls in one briefing. No digging. Just read.

"Create a pre-listing briefing for [address]." Property summary, recent comps, market context. Organized and ready.

BUYER REPRESENTATION

"What inventory moved in this neighborhood over the past month?" Current picture of supply, velocity, and price movement.

"How competitive is the market in my area right now?" Days on market, list-to-sale ratios, multiple offers. The full read.

"What should my buyers know before making an offer on 123 Main Street?" Flags relevant comps, price movement, anything about the property or seller.

"Walk me through the comps Breezy selected for this property and why." Transparency. Understand the reasoning so you can agree, push back, or adjust.

"How does X offer compare to recently sold comps?" Pressure-test the number before you go in.

PRICING AND MARKET INTELLIGENCE

"What's the UnderBuilt potential on 123 Main Street?" Build potential analysis based on zoning and market data. The kind of insight that turns a showing into a development conversation.

"What pricing trends should I be paying attention to in this market?" Macro read on direction and velocity.

"What developments could impact future values near 123 Main Street?" Useful for buyers and sellers thinking beyond the immediate transaction.

"Explain what's happening in this neighborhood right now." Clean market summary you can use directly in a client conversation.

PROSPECTING AND FOLLOW-UP

"Draft a follow-up email after my first meeting with Jane Smith." Written from your meeting notes. Sounds like you, not a template.

"Create a call script for a homeowner interested in expanding their property." A starting point for conversations where build potential is relevant.

"Write a market update for my sphere." Personalized to the markets you actually work.

"Who in my pipeline haven't I followed up with in the last two weeks?" Breezy surfaces who's falling through the cracks before you miss them.

"Draft a check-in message for Jane Smith about the listing at 123 Main Street." Context-aware outreach based on where the deal actually stands.

PRODUCTIVITY AND PIPELINE

"Summarize today's meetings." What was discussed, decided, and what needs to happen next.

"Create follow-up tasks from my last three client calls." Breezy scans your notes and pulls the commitments you made.

"What are my highest-priority deals right now?" Pipeline visibility without the spreadsheet.

"What's the status of every deal I have in contract?" One place, one read. No chasing.

"I'm heading to an open house at 123 Main Street]. What do I need to know?" Recent sales, days on market, your notes. In the time it takes to park.
